But we begin today with Tiger Woods arrested on suspicion of DUI, property damage and refusal to submit

to a lawful test after a roll over car accident in Jupiter Island, Florida. Woods's car was reportedly one of two cars involved with no reported injuries. Police say Woods appeared impaired, passed the breathalyzer, but refused to give a urine sample. Five years ago, Woods suffered massive trauma to his right leg in a one car accident outside of Los Angeles. We'll find we have so much more to learn.

At the University of Oregon, on this day 87 years ago, Oregon won the first ever NCAA Basketball Tournament,

defeating Ohio State 46-33 in the championship game of what was then an eight-team field. Oregon did not return to the final four until 2017. Oregon has become a legitimate football power in recent years. The same cannot be said about the duck's basketball team this year. Oregon finished 16th in the big 10 this year.

For those of you keeping track, the big 10 has 18 teams. Oregon lived in 12 and 20. It's worth season under Dana Altman and it's fewest win since eight wins in 2009. Then Altman came in and rattled off 15 consecutive 20 win seasons before this year's dud. You know where that final four was, Tony, I was there today.
